SteveR Posted March 27, 2007 Share Posted March 27, 2007 The current set had/has some very-good parts but an equal number of very-bad parts.On the white jerseys, I really like the way the black numbers w/ bronze trim show against the white background. I like the eagle logo but it lost its place in the team look after Leonsis took over and made the dome the logo of primary use. (It's at center ice, it's on the press guide and the letterhead on all team stationery) And I never cared for the angled stripes.The black jerseys were a great third but they don't hold up as a 41-use-per-season set. The bronze-on-black does not show well from a distance or on TV. I was at a Caps practice once and saw someone with a personalized black jersey with white letters and numbers w/ bronze trim. Talk about sharp!And on the dome logo, I think it would be 100% improved if you just removed the panel with the team name on it. Just the dome, the crossed sticks and the puck. Even if you don't know the team name, that's enough to convey that this is the logo of the hockey team in Washington, D.C.To me, the best logos don't need words in them.
